Subaru key fobs are a little different from those from other manufacturers. They employ a distinct chip and algorithm. This flaw has enabled hackers to duplicate and copy Subaru fobs. The problem was spotted by Tom Wimmenhove, an electronics designer who discovered a straightforward hack that could be used to duplicate Subaru fobs that have keys and gain access to cars. The hack works by taking the rolling unlock and lock codes that are transmitted by the fobs, and then analyzing them. The result is a collection of predictable or sequential codes which can be duplicated on the Raspberry Pi for around $25.

Transponder keys

Many vehicles that are equipped with a transponder chip also come with an anti-theft feature. Transponder keys (also called "chip keys") include an embedded microchip which transmits a signal the receiver, which is located in the car. The receiver is looking for the specific signal and only allow the key to be used to start your vehicle. This is a great way to stop thieves from stealing your vehicle's hot-wire.

When the key is inserted in the ignition and the engine control unit (ECU) sends out an email to the transponder chip. The chip responds by sending a unique digital serial code that matches the ECU database. This trick makes the car believe that the key is genuine, and makes it start.
